ELECTRONIC VEHICLE INFORMATION CENTER (EVIC) OR DRIVER
INFORMATION DISPLAY (DID)
The EVIC/DID features an interactive display that is located in the instrument cluster.
Pushing the controls on the left side of the steering wheel allows the driver to select
vehicle information and Personal Settings. Refer to “EVIC/DID Programmable
Features” in this section for further information.
Push and release the UP
arrow
button to scroll upward through the
main menus and submenus (Digital
Speedometer, Vehicle Info, Fuel
Economy Info, Trip A, Trip B, Stop/
Start, Trailer Tow, Audio, Stored Mes-
sages, Screen Setup, Vehicle Set-
tings).
Push and release the DOWN
arrow
button to scroll downward through the
main menus and submenus.
Push and release the RIGHT
arrow
button for access to main menus, sub-
menus or to select a personal setting
in the setup menu. Push and hold the
RIGHT
arrow button for two sec-
onds to reset features.
Push and release the LEFT
arrow button to scroll back to a previous menu or
submenu.
Compass Calibration
This compass is self-calibrating, which eliminates the need to set the compass
manually. When the vehicle is new, the compass may appear erratic, and the
EVIC/DID will display “CAL” until the compass is calibrated.
You may also calibrate the compass by completing one or more 360 degree turns (in
an area free from large metal or metallic objects) until the “CAL” message displayed
in the EVIC/DID turns off. The compass will now function normally.
